2019백업

    주식트레이딩을 하는 중에 안되는 부분

    책을 따라 하면서 안되는 부분을 블로그에 올린다 1. 64비트 아나콘다로 인해 증권api와 연결이 안되는 문제, 파이썬 zipline 패키지를 사용시에 발생하는 에러문제 2. 키움 api 로그인 시 생기는 문제

    Chapter3_1정리(Day 7일차)

    ※출처: 2018 데이터분석 준전문가 ADsP 챕터3 1장 데이터 분석 개요 데이터 처리 과정 데이터 분석을 위해서는 DW나 DM를 통해 분석데이터를 구성해야 한다. 신규데이터나 DW에 없는 데이터는 기존 운영시스템(legacy)에서 가져오기 보다는 운영시스템에서 임시로 데이터를 저장하는 스테이징영역에서 데이터를 전처리해서 운영데이터저장소에 저장된 데이터를 DW와 DM 와 결합하여 데이터를 구성하도록 한다. 시각화 기법 가장 낮은 수준의 분석이지만 복잡한 분석을 보다 더 효율적으로 해석할 수 있어 빅데이터 분석에서 필수적인 분석방법이다. 여러 차트형식의 시각화와 트리구조, 다이어그램 맵, 워드크라우드 등이 있다. 공간분석 공간적 차원과 관련된 속성들을 시각화하는 분석으로 지도위에 관련된 속성들을 생성하고..

    mysql고급문법

    숫자 데이터 형식숫자형 데이터 형식은 정수, 실수 등의 숫자를 표현한다. 데이터 형식바이트 수 숫자 범위설명BIT(N)N/B 1~64bit를 표현,b10000 형식으로 표현 TINYINT1-128 ~ 127정수★SMALLINT2-32,768 ~ 32,767정수MEDIUMINT3-8,388,608~8,388,607정수★INTINTEGER4약 –21억 ~ +21억정수★BIGINT8약 –900경~ +900경정수★FLOAT4-3.4E+38~1.17E-38소수점 아래 7자리까지 표현★DOUBLEREAL8-1.22E-308~1.79E+308소수점 아래 15자리까지 표현★DECIMAL(m,(d))NUMERIC(m,(d))5~17-10 +1~+10 -1 UNSIGNED 예약어TINYINT 0~255, SMALLINT ..

    5장 SQL의 기본

    SQL 기본 Select 열이름FROM 테이블이름WHERE 조건 USE 구문 use 데이터베이스_이름 SELECT Name, height FROM userTBl WHERE height >= 180 AND height SELECT Name, height FROM userTBl WHERE height BETWEEN 180 AND 183;연속적인 데이터는 between SELECT Name, addr FROM userTBl; WHERE add IN (‘경남’,‘전남’,‘경북’,‘전북’);이산적인 데이터는 IN을 사용한다. SELECT Name, addr FROM userTBl WHERE addr = ‘경남 OR addr= ’전남‘ OR addr = ’경북‘ OR addr = ’전북‘; 경남 혹은 전남 혹은 경..

    데이터분석 4장 핵심

    ※출처 : 2018 데이터분석 준전문가 ADsP 분석기획 방향성 도출 1) 분석기회 : 실제 분석을 수행하기 전에 분석과제를 정의하고 의도했던 결과를 도출할 수 있도록 적절하게 편리할 수 있는 방안을 사전 에 계획하는 일련의 작업. 분석의 대상 (what) Known Un-Known Known Optimization Insight Un-known Solution Discover y 분석의 방법(How) 2)목표 시점 별 분석 기획 방안의 차이 당면한 분석 주제의 해결(과제단위) 지소적 분석 문화 내재화(마스터 플랜 단위) Speed & Test 1차 목표 Accuracy & Deploy Quick & Win 과제의 유형 Long Term View Problem Solving 접근방식 Problem Def..

    4장 데이터 모델링

    4장 데이터 모델링 MySQL은 RDBMS(관계형 데이터베이스 매니저먼트 시스템) 4.1 프로젝트 진행 단계 프로젝트란 현실세계의 업무를 컴퓨터 시스템으로 옮겨놓는 일련의 과정 몇몇 뛰어난 프로그래머에게 의존하는 형태를 취해왔다. -> 실패가 많아짐 이러한 문제점을 해결하기 위해서 ‘소프트웨어 개발 방법론’이 나타났다. ex) 소프트웨어 공학 , 가장 오래되고 전통적으로 사용되는 것은 폭포수 모델 폭포수 모델 프로젝트 계획 -> 업무분석 -> 시스템 설계 -> 프로그램 구현 -> 테스트 -> 유지보수 4.2 데이터베이스 모델링 4.2.1 데이터베이스 모델링의 개념 업무 분석, 시스템 설계에서 데이터베이스 설계, 모델링이 필요하다. 현실세계에 있는 상품이나 고객, 직원을 넣을 수는 없으니 특징들을 추출해서..

    3장

    3장. MySQL 전체 운영 실습 정보시스템을 구축하기 위해서 분석, 설계, 구현, 테스트, 유지보수 5가지 단계가 존재한다. 데이터베이스 모델링 : 현실세계에서 사용되는 데이터를 MySQL에 어떻게 옮겨 놓을 것인지를 결정하는 과정 (ex: 사람-> 주민등록번호,제품-> 이름,제품번호) MySQL에서는 Schema와 Database는 똑같은 말이다. Create table `my table`(id int); 숫자 1옆에 있는 `을 사용하면 띄워쓰기한 테이블이름을 가질수 있다. 3.3.1 인덱스 찾아보기와 같은 개념 , 이 인덱스를 잘 활용하지 못해서 시스템의 성능이 전체적으로 느린 경우가 아주 흔하게 있다. create index idx_indexTBL_firstname on indexTBL(first..